Two-Bedroom Apartment
2 × Twin bed36 ㎡up to 4
Featuring a private entrance, this apartment also consists of 2 bedrooms, a seating area and 1 bathroom with a shower and a hairdryer. The well-fitted kitchenette features a stovetop, a refrigerator, kitchenware and an oven. Boasting a balcony with sea views, this apartment also provides a dining area and a flat-screen TV with streaming services. The unit offers 3 beds.
